CI troubleshooting note for security review: the Fernwick report exporter previously converted timestamps using the build agent's local timezone, causing nondeterministic diffs between runs. We now pin all export rendering to UTC and pass the user's offset explicitly, removing any dependence on host configuration. No credential or data-handling paths changed. The audited build token follows.

build token for kagaf-hahof: htk14_9d3d4d26d7d8de

**Mgmt Meeting Minutes — Retiring the Brightline Range**

Quick recap for sales leads at Fenholt Supplies: we agreed to retire the Brightline fixture range by year-end. Remaining stock moves to clearance pricing next month, and accounts on standing orders get migrated to the Lumetta range. Trade-in incentives were approved in principle. The confidential note on next steps sits just below.

board note of bajof-bajeg: The pricing group signed off on a budget of $13.4 million for Project Sildor. The renewal with Lamixek Holdings closes at $48.9 million a year, 49 percent above the last contract.

Subject: DR drill Thursday — pinning policy repo

Reviewer heads-up: Thursday's disaster-recovery drill simulates total loss of the Lockstitch policy repo, which enforces dependency pinning across the Moorfield monorepo. Expect CI to go red for ~30 minutes; don't approve unpin PRs during the window. Restore order: mirror sync, policy re-seed, checksum verification. Your only manual step is unlocking the restore bundle when prompted. The bundle unlock requires the drill recovery passphrase, included just below.

recovery phrase for bafof-kajof: quenmir-ralmir-praeth

Handover — Garrick Deck occupancy feed. Feed publisher (Stallgate v3) polls the gate sensors every 20s; Deck C sensor flaps after rain, dedupe logic handles it. Consumers: the Waybourne city dashboard and two internal caches. If counts drift negative, restart the aggregator — known bug, fix lands next sprint. Alerts route to the on-call channel; ack within 15 min or the city feed marks us stale. Config lives in the sealed ops vault. To open it during an incident, use the recovery passphrase, which is:

vault phrase of bagaf-kajeg = jorath-feniel-briir-siliel-ralix